#378df4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#378df4 is composed of 21.6% red, 55.3%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 42.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 212.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 58.6%. #378df4 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effff with #001be9.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#378df4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#378df4 has RGB values of R:55, G:141,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 3640820.

Shades and Tints of #378df4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000205 is the darkest color, while #f1f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#378df4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#90959b is the less saturated color, while #2f8cfc is the most saturated one.
